The Art of Destruction: Perfecting the Shredded Look

To master the shredded look, you must approach it with purpose. Get a sharp blade or scissors. Plan your cuts. Start with small slits or tears on knees, thighs, or calves. You can create horizontal cuts, then pull at the fabric to make holes bigger. Or, cut parallel lines, then pull threads for a laddered effect. Wash the leggings after cutting. This will fray edges, and give them an authentic, worn appearance. This is not damage; it is a calculated act of defiance.

Patchwork Rebellion: Adding Patches & Fabric

Patches tell your story. They show your loyalties and your beliefs. Gather patches from bands, causes, or symbols that resonate with you. Iron-on patches are easy, but sewing provides stronger, more lasting attachment. You can also sew on scraps of contrasting fabric, like plaid, faux leather, or denim. Place these under rips, or stitch them directly onto solid areas. Mix textures and patterns. Each piece contributes to your personal manifesto.

A Splash of Anarchy: Bleach & Paint

Unleash chaos with color. Bleach can create striking patterns. Apply it carefully with a brush for streaks, or spray it for splatters. You can also dip sections of leggings into a bleach solution for an ombre effect. Always dilute bleach and wear gloves. Fabric paint is another tool. Use stencils for clear designs, or freehand your own motifs. Skulls, symbols, or bold words work well. Allow paint to dry fully before wearing. You now have leggings that bear your artistic mark.

Installing Studs & Spikes

Studs and spikes add an aggressive, tactile edge to your punk leggings for women. You need specific tools for this, like a stud setter or a pair of pliers. Choose from cone, pyramid, or dome studs. Decide on placement. Lines along seams, clusters on knees, or scattered across hips are common. Mark your spots with chalk. Push the prongs through the fabric, then bend them flat on the inside. Ensure they are secure. Each metal piece reinforces your armor, creating a formidable punk leggings outfit.

The D-Ring & Harness Method

D-rings and harnesses bring an industrial, bondage-inspired aesthetic. You can sew D-rings directly onto fabric tabs, then attach straps to create a harness effect around the thighs or waist. Or, install eyelets into your leggings. Thread webbing or chain through these eyelets. This creates adjustable elements or fixed decorative straps. You can even build a full, removable harness for your punk rave leggings. This method adds structure and a commanding attitude to your custom gear.

How do I care for punk leggings for women with special details like mesh, leather, or studs?

Your punk leggings for women are your armor, so they need proper care to last. Always check the care label first; it gives specific instructions. For items with mesh, faux leather, or studs, hand washing is usually the safest method. Use cold water and a mild detergent. Turn the leggings inside out to protect the details. Gently squeeze out excess water, but do not wring them. Air dry your punk leggings flat or hang them carefully. Avoid direct sunlight or high heat, because this can damage fabrics and embellishments. Special items like punk rave leggings often have unique details, so treating them carefully ensures their longevity.
